PAINTING OPERATOR
1. Introduction
A Painting Operator is responsible for applying coatings, paints, or finishes to products and surfaces in manufacturing or production settings. This role requires precision, color accuracy, and adherence to safety and quality standards.
2. Job Description Details
The job involves preparing surfaces, mixing and applying paint or coatings, operating painting equipment, and inspecting finished products for quality. Painting Operators ensure consistent coverage, proper curing, and defect-free finishes while complying with production timelines and safety guidelines.
3. Key Responsibilities
- Prepare and clean surfaces prior to painting.
- Mix paints, coatings, or finishes according to specifications.
- Apply paints and coatings using brushes, rollers, or spray equipment.
- Inspect painted surfaces for coverage, color accuracy, and defects.
- Maintain painting equipment and work area cleanliness.
- Follow safety protocols, including use of PPE and ventilation guidelines.
- Document production and painting activities as required.
4. Skills & Qualifications
- Experience in painting or surface coating in a production environment.
- Knowledge of paint mixing, application techniques, and curing processes.
- Attention to detail and color accuracy.
- Ability to operate painting equipment safely and efficiently.
- Physically capable of standing for long periods and performing repetitive tasks.
- Teamwork, reliability, and adherence to safety standards.
5. Tools & Equipment Used
- Paint brushes, rollers, and spray guns
- Air compressors and painting booths
- Mixing containers and measuring tools
- Protective equipment (masks, gloves, aprons)
- Inspection and surface preparation tools
